Transaction f7f4e4c37b6fa5cd60fe2d78b0f4e935f1e2a2972690b658ca1f974310a77588

100 Input
1 Outputs
  • f7f4e4c37b6fa5cd60fe2d78b0f4e935f1e2a2972690b658ca1f974310a77588:0
  • value  28725151
    address  329eSbN5vSbBqyqeydBdhVLzB3nnJxXAXR